LIGURIA, YES TO CIRCUMCISION IN PUBLIC HEALTH FACILITIES
|
Experimentation will begin in public health facilities in the Liguria region for male circumcision in day surgery. Decided by the regional Junta in Liguria after a proposal by regional health councilman Claudio Montaldo, who received requests from various communities in Liguria. The provision will guarantee the practice of circumcision for children of anyone who makes a request, and will be carried out in Liguria public health facilities. The experimental activity will be carried out on 120 patients in the region who are under the age of 14. "Since this is about health procedures that have nothing to do with the presence of a pathology- explained the health councilman in the region - we will ask for citizens who request this service to pay a fee of 100 euro per procedure".
Along with the revenue that will come from those receiving the procedure and paying the fee, the region has set aside 90,000 euro for the first year of experimentation. At the end of the year long experiment, public heath agencies and their equivalents will prepare a financial statement for the economic aspect and in terms of procedures carried out, which will be liquidated by the region. At the end of the experiment, circumcision will be inserted among the procedures normally carried out by public heath facilities. "The goal of this provision- concluded Montaldo - that regards everyone, is to offer the most appropriate opportunity with regard to hygiene and to do it in such a way that there are no negative consequences on the subject who is circumcised, resulting in possible costs derived from treatments for complications".
